Reality TV takes centre stage this August on Showmax. Whether you’re addicted to international drama like The Valley or swept up in Next Gen NYC, the latest obsession for Housewives fans, or you’re all about African Originals like The Mommy Club Nairobi or Vaal Riviera, there’s something for every kind of viewer!

KING’S COURT S1  
Thursdays from 14 August on Showmax

Supermodel Tyson Beckford, NBA All-Star Carlos Boozer and WWE legend Thaddeus “Titus O’Neil” Bullard are searching for their queen on King’s Court.  

A spinoff from Queen’s Court, the reality series introduces them to 21 smart, accomplished and beautiful single ladies ready to risk it all for The One. 

In each episode, the kings take the women on fun, adventurous dates to discover which of them tug at their heartstrings. The ladies pull out all the stops to make a lasting impression but it comes to a head at the elimination dinner party, where the men choose who gets another chance at love and who goes home. After navigating a roller coaster of emotional highs, dramatic lows and tough eliminations, the kings must ultimately decide which of these fabulous ladies will be their queen. 

KOKKEDOOR VUUR EN VLAM S2  
Binge from Friday, 15 August on Showmax 

Produced by Homebrew Films, kykNET’s SAFTA-winning cooking show Kokkedoor: Vuur & Vlam turns up the heat in this sizzling spin-off of the beloved Afrikaans cooking competition. 

Set in the heart of the Karoo, this season brings fire, flavour, and fierce rivalries as South Africa’s boldest braai masters battle it out over the coals, trying to impress celebrity judges Bertus Basson and Kobus Botha.

NEXT GEN NYC S1  
Binge now on Showmax 

Next Gen NYC follows a group of ambitious young movers, creators, and disruptors navigating life, love, and hustle in the city that never slows down.

The cast features a fresh mix of familiar faces and rising stars, including The Real Housewives offspring Riley Burrus, Ariana Biermann, Brook Marks and Gia Giudice, as well as Ava Dash, the daughter of hip-hop mogul Damon Dash.  

Set against the electric backdrop of New York City, the reality series dives into the personal and professional lives of this new generation, from career breakthroughs and creative risks to messy relationships and unfiltered friendships.

THE MOMMY CLUB NBO S1 REUNION  
Showmax Original: Kenya | Stream from Friday, 29 August  

The highly anticipated reunion of The Mommy Club NBO lands on Friday, 29 August. After a season packed with power moves, clashing personalities and shifting alliances, the big question remains: will the ladies finally find common ground, or is the divide deeper than ever?

Set in Nairobi, The Mommy Club NBO is the fifth instalment of the record-breaking franchise, following successful editions in South Africa and Tanzania. The series follows Jackie Matubia, DJ Pierra Makena, Carey Priscilla, Lynne Njihia and South African Ofentse Tsipa, five affluent and ambitious mothers balancing family, fame and fierce friendships in the spotlight.

THE VALLEY S2  
Binge on Showmax from Thursday, 21 August 

Where Vanderpump Rules goes, drama isn’t far behind – and Bravo’s latest spin-off, The Valley, is no exception.   

Boasting Bravo’s most-watched series premiere in nearly 10 years, the reality TV series follows a group of close friends as they trade bottle service in West Hollywood for baby bottles in the Valley, all while they navigate bustling businesses, rocky relationships and feisty friendships. 

After wrapping up Season 1 with two shocking divorces, the cast is showing that they’re anything but predictable California suburbanites in Season 2. Highlights this season include an engagement and guest appearances from Vanderpump Rules’ Lala Kent, Scheana Schay and Tom Schwartz. 

VAAL RIVIERA 
Showmax Original: South Africa | Stream from Friday 22 August, with new episodes on Tuesdays 

From POP24, the producers of The Mommy Club: Van Die Hoofstad, the most-watched Afrikaans reality show on Showmax, comes Vaal Riviera, a new reality series set in Vanderbijlpark and Vereeniging. 

The Vaal might not have Pretoria’s polish, but the families here bring just as much heat. Meet the Arangies, the Snymans, the Deysels, and the Swarts, four bold, proudly local Afrikaans families navigating love, loyalty, legacy and plenty of drama on the banks of the Vaal River.
This is small-town living with big personalities, real stakes, and a whole lot of heart.
